5. TROUBLESHOOTING 

 

 

Problem 

Cause 

Check 

Solution 

Valve does not open 

1.

 

The Inlet pressure is 
too low 

1.

 

Check the inlet 
pressure 

 

1.

 

 Make sure that the water supply 
(or the pump) is on. 

2.

 

The 

3

-Way selector 

(

3

) is set to "close". 

2.

 

Check the position of 
the 

3

-way selector (

3

2.

 

 Turn the 

3

-Way selector (

3

) to 

"auto". 

3.

 

Blocked pilot 

3.

 

No water coming out 
of the pilot #

2

 port. 

3.

 

 Contact  A.R.I.’s field service 

4.

 

The pilot’s adjusting 
bolt (

4A

) is 

completely open  

4.

 

Check the position of 
the pilot’s adjusting 
bolt (

4A

)  

4.

 

 Turn the adjusting bolt (

4A

clockwise, one turn at a time, 
allowing sometime between turns 
for the valve to respond. Continue 
until the required pressure is 
reached. 

Valve does not close 

1.

 

Debris on the sealing 
seat 

1.

 

The valve is constantly 
discharging small 
amount of water 

1.

 

  Turn the 

3

-way selector (

3

) to 

"open" for 

5

 seconds, and then to 

"close". 
If the problem continues, turn off 
the water supply to the valve.  
Remove the bonnet and 
diaphragm, remove the foreign 
object, and check that the 
diaphragm, body and cover are not 
damaged. 

2.

 

The diaphragm is 
damaged 

2.

 

The valve is constantly 
discharging small 
amount of water 

2.

 

 Turn off the water supply to the 
valve.  Remove the bonnet and 
replace the diaphragm. 

3.

 

The 

3

-Way selector is 

in the "open" 
position. 

3.

 

Check the 

3

-way 

selector. 

3.

 

 Turn the 

3

-Way selector (

3

) to 

"auto" or "close" position 

4.

 

Blocked self-flushing 
filter (

2

). 

4.

 

Disconnect the 
control tube from the 
self-flushing filter (

2

and check for free 
water flow. 

4.

 

 Turn off the water supply to the 
valve, remove the finger-filter and 
clean or replace it. 

Unstable downstream 
pressure  

Blocked or damaged 
pilot 

Unstable pressure 
downstream of the 
valve 

Contact A.R.I.'s field service  

Incorrect but stable 
downstream pressure 

Wrong preset pressure 

 

Readjust the downstream pressure 
as described in the Initial Set-up 
chapter (

2.4

).
